The Diocesan Administration of Chistopol discussed a set of measures to prevent the spread of coronavirus infection

14 January 2021, Thursday

On January 13, the Diocesan Administration of Chistopol held a meeting to discuss a set of measures aimed at preventing the spread of coronavirus infection in the diocese territory.

 

The event was attended by Bishop Ignatii of Chistopol and Nizhnekamsk, the fathers-deans of the church deanery districts, and deans' assistants. At a meeting with the clergy were invited: the Deputy head of the City of Chistopol municipality Michael Ksenofontov, head of territorial Department of management of Federal service on supervision in of protection of consumer rights and human welfare sphere for the Republic of Tatarstan in Chistopol, Spassk, Alekseevsk, Novosheshminsk districts Flyura Khairullina, chief doctor of Central Municipal Hospital of Chistopol Rais Mustafin, Deputy head of the police department of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russian Federation in Chistopol area Vasily Kuzmin. Bishop Ignatii addressed all present with a welcoming speech.

During his speech, the ruling bishop called on the clergy to strictly follow the sanitary services' instructions and carry out all necessary anti-epidemic measures on the territory of the churches of the Chistopol diocese.

The head of the Chistopol territorial department of Rospotrebnadzor, Flura Khairullina, reported on the sanitary and epidemiological situation in the Chistopol municipal district and the prevention of coronavirus infection. She told about the current sanitary and epidemiological situation in the Chistopol municipal district, coronavirus infection features, and measures for its prevention. She appealed to the audience to observe disinfection and masking regimes on churches' territory and the observance of social distance during services.

Deputy head of the City of Chistopol municipal formation Mikhail Ksenofontov reported ongoing activities aimed at preventing the spread of coronavirus infection in the district. During the meeting, Rais R. Mustafin spoke about a temporary infectious hospital based on the city's second central hospital and about measures on rendering medical aid to patients with community-acquired pneumonia and novel coronavirus infection.

Separately, the chief physician reported on the beginning of vaccination of the population, first of all, among medical workers with a two-component vector vaccine against COVID-19 - Gam-COVID-Vak, the trademark Sputnik V.  "To form immunity, vaccination against COVID-19 consists of two stages of administration. The second stage of administration is carried out 21 days after the first. On January 6, the second component of the Gam-COVID-Vak vaccine was introduced to previously vaccinated medical workers," Rais Robertovich said. He believes that mass vaccination will stop the coronavirus pandemic and shared his personal experience  with the second phase of vaccination. "I feel good, live an everyday intensive life, go to work, and do not experience discomfort," said the chief doctor.

Deputy chief of police Department of Chistopol area Vasily Kuzmin reported at the end of the meeting. He spoke about the measures implemented to detect and prevent violations of the established rules and prosecute perpetrators connected with mask mode failure in terms of the spread of coronavirus infection.
